| Battle Schools: Why It Can Be Successful and Why It Can Suck. | ||||||
| Those who dwell in LTU know atleast about some of the Battle Schools that took place, past and present. In fact, most of them could probably they said've participated in one and learned a thing or two about how to duel. But, as we may or may not know, many of the battle schools never seem to last very long. Perhaps because it was out of boredom. Maybe it was out of laziness. Though the fad was huge in the past, today battle schools don't seem too very common, and they die pretty easily. According to LTU records, the first ever battle school was created by ragnorok69. It took place in the LTU board itself about a year and a half ago, and it was quite original at the time. "There was a large influx of new people at the time who were making alot of topics about learning how to fight, or asking questions," says raggy himself. "Seemed like a good idea, a wonder no one thought of it before." Being only called The Battle School, many of the old veterans learned pretty well how to fight RP style. They learned the art of True, Cheeze, and Mix. Some favored one style, while others fought in several. But it can be easily said that this Battle School started something on LTU that had probably changed the board forever. However, the battle school wasn't perfect. "Different teachers had different ideas about what to do and what not to do," he continues. "At first the rules of teaching were a bit strict, and there were not enough teachers to teach all the people who signed up." Like all other things, the battle school had to come to an end. However legendary (or not) may it sound, there was no longer any time for ragnorok and the others to teach the students. "Lack of time of me and the other teachers," he says. With the fall of The Battle School, others popped up. Most of the masters of these schools were also pupils at ragnorok's school, and so they would pass on what they learned to new people. The few that popped out included The LTU Battle School, claimed by chickengobawk, The Elbonian Wakeen, by Elbonian Man, Zelrais Academy, by Lord Wiergraf, and The LZA Battle School, by Vegetaman. There were many others, the majority of them failing faster then they came up. But what was interesting was why they had failed. "I got to lazy to update it," says cgb. "Should've kept reminding people to come," replies Weir, who feels it was his fault his school failed. "...people stopped coming, and I got bored with it." So one of the main reasons is that people either never had the time, or were quite too lazy to continue such a commitment. The same case goes for Vegetaman, who currently owns the LZA Battle School, still active today. However, the school itself, formerly known as Vegetaman's Battle School, closed once beforehand, and this was also due to the lack of time. But, with LZA claiming to be quite active, Vegetaman opened the doors to his school once again, where its fellow members are being trained even today. "Well, it's progressing fairly well," says the LZA leader. It doesn't seem to likely that more Battle Schools would be created. With the start of school coming this fall, more and more people would become busier as the days go by.
